Why These Are the Top Walk-in Tubs Contractors in Jones Mills

** The walk-in tub market for Jones Mills, PA, is characterized by a reliance on regional and county-wide service providers rather than businesses physically located within the small town itself. The competition is moderate, with several reputable contractors in nearby hubs like Greensburg, Jeannette, and Latrobe actively serving the area. The average quality of service is high, as these established businesses rely on strong reputations and word-of-mouth in the community. Typical pricing for a walk-in tub project in this region can vary widely based on the tub's features (e.g., basic vs. hydrotherapy), the complexity of the installation, and whether it's part of a larger bathroom remodel. Homeowners should expect a starting price range of **$5,000 to $8,000** for a standard tub and professional installation, with high-end models and full bathroom modifications easily reaching **$15,000 to $25,000 or more**. It is highly recommended to obtain multiple, detailed quotes and to verify state licensing and insurance for any provider before committing to a project.

Frequently Asked Questions About Walk-in Tubs in Jones Mills

Get answers to common questions about walk-in tubs services in Jones Mills, Pennsylvania.

1What is the typical cost range for a walk-in tub installation in Jones Mills, and are there any Pennsylvania-specific financial assistance programs?

A complete walk-in tub installation in the Jones Mills area typically ranges from $5,000 to $15,000+, depending on the tub model, features, and the complexity of your bathroom's plumbing and electrical work. Pennsylvania offers potential financial assistance through the PA Department of Aging's OPTIONS program for eligible seniors, and some local providers may offer financing. It's also wise to check if your project qualifies for a Pennsylvania sales tax exemption on medical equipment.

2How long does a full walk-in tub installation take, and should I consider seasonal timing in Westmoreland County?

From consultation to completion, a standard installation typically takes 1-3 days. Given Jones Mills' cold winters, scheduling installation in spring or fall is often ideal, as contractors are more readily available and you avoid potential delays from winter weather. This also allows for any necessary plumbing work to be done comfortably before freezing temperatures set in.

3Are there local regulations or permits required for installing a walk-in tub in my Jones Mills home?

Yes, most installations in Pennsylvania require a plumbing permit from your local municipality (Jones Mills Borough or the relevant township). Reputable local installers will typically handle this process for you. It's crucial to ensure your provider is licensed and insured in Pennsylvania, as this guarantees the work meets state and local building codes, which is important for both safety and home resale value.

4What should I look for when choosing a local walk-in tub service provider in the Jones Mills area?

Prioritize providers with strong local references, verifiable Pennsylvania contractor licensing, and in-house installation teams (not subcontractors). Look for companies experienced with older home plumbing common in Westmoreland County. A trustworthy provider will offer a free, in-home consultation to assess your specific bathroom layout and discuss options like low-step thresholds and hydrotherapy jets suitable for your needs.

5I'm concerned about the tub door seal leaking. Is this a common issue, and how is it addressed in our climate?

Modern walk-in tubs have highly effective, inward-opening door seals that prevent leaks when installed correctly. A reputable local installer will ensure a perfect fit and test it thoroughly. In Jones Mills' humid summers and dry winters, high-quality seals are designed to remain pliable and effective. Your provider should offer a strong warranty on both the tub seal and their installation labor for long-term peace of mind.
